Anyhow, had a decat fitted to my 180 bhp cupra which is remapped yesterday.

Full 3" system turbo back, de cat then cobra resonated mid section and cobra 6x4 oval backbox.

All seemed well at first, it smoked a little because it was new, but then today things have got strange.

First of all the engine management light hasnt came on, ive done about 100 miles so far.

The car smells really strong of fuel from the exhaust fumes?

After a run, if its sat ticking over, itl puff blue smoke out for about 5 - 10 seconds lightly, then stop? Smells oily?

Power feels down compared to what it was before, also if im at the revs where its about to spool the turbo up and i let off the throttle, the exhaust sort of barks and makes a loud sound for a couple of seconds as if i blipped the throttle when i didnt?

Booked in at r tech 5th april for checkover just wondered if anyone could answer any of these in the meantime?
 
You now have less back pressure in the exhaust, this will show up any small issues the car has with it's oil seals. You aren't the first person to have this problem after a decat, I have deffo read threads like this before.

Hello mate. The Blue smoke is oil being burnt from the turbo. This happens when the there is no pressure going through the turbo, oil seeps in through the seals and is burnt hence the blue smoke. To be honest you need to get this fixed with either a recon unit or a new one or even send yours away for repair if you can do without your car for a week.
